Unsafe abortion in Brazil is currently the fifth cause of maternal mortality, being considered by
the World Health Organization a public health problem since 1967. This paper aims, through
analysis of statistical data obtained from the SIM - Mortality Information System, through
DATASUS platform and cross-referencing with data obtained from the National Council of
Justice on abortion crime cases that occurred throughout the national territory, with a specific
analysis of the State of Bahia, from 2014-2018, using the feminist perspective on sexual and
reproductive rights of women attended by the Unified Health System, through literature review.
